The MSP430FR6888IPZ is an integrated circuit chip from Texas Instruments' MSP430FRx FRAM microcontroller series. It offers several advantages and can be applied in various scenarios. Some of the advantages and application scenarios of the MSP430FR6888IPZ are:Advantages: 1. Ultra-low power consumption: The chip is designed for low-power applications, consuming very little energy during operation. This makes it suitable for battery-powered devices and applications where power efficiency is crucial.2. Non-volatile FRAM memory: The chip utilizes Ferroelectric Random Access Memory (FRAM) technology, which combines the benefits of both Flash memory and RAM. FRAM offers fast read/write access, high endurance, and low power consumption, making it ideal for data logging, sensor data storage, and other applications requiring frequent data updates.3. Integrated peripherals: The MSP430FR6888IPZ includes various integrated peripherals such as analog-to-digital converters (ADCs), digital-to-analog converters (DACs), timers, UART, I2C, SPI, and more. These peripherals enable easy interfacing with external devices and simplify the design of complex systems.4. Low operating voltage: The chip operates at low voltages, typically ranging from 1.8V to 3.6V. This allows it to be used in applications where power supply constraints exist.Application Scenarios: 1. Internet of Things (IoT) devices: The MSP430FR6888IPZ's low power consumption, FRAM memory, and integrated peripherals make it suitable for IoT applications. It can be used in sensor nodes, smart home devices, wearable devices, and other IoT edge devices.2. Industrial automation: The chip's low power consumption and integrated peripherals make it suitable for industrial automation applications. It can be used in motor control systems, process control units, and other industrial monitoring and control devices.3. Portable medical devices: The low power consumption and FRAM memory of the chip make it suitable for portable medical devices such as glucose meters, heart rate monitors, and blood pressure monitors. The integrated peripherals enable easy integration with sensors and communication modules.4. Energy harvesting systems: The MSP430FR6888IPZ's low power consumption and FRAM memory make it suitable for energy harvesting systems. It can be used in applications where energy is harvested from ambient sources such as solar, thermal, or vibration, and stored in the FRAM memory for later use.5. Smart agriculture: The chip's low power consumption and integrated peripherals make it suitable for smart agriculture applications. It can be used in soil moisture sensors, weather stations, and irrigation control systems, enabling efficient use of resources and improved crop yield.Overall, the MSP430FR6888IPZ integrated circuit chip offers low power consumption, FRAM memory, and integrated peripherals, making it suitable for a wide range of applications requiring low-power operation, data storage, and interfacing capabilities.
